The Gentle Power of Ursodiol in Supporting Liver Function
Ursodiol, also known as ursodeoxycholic acid or UDCA, is a naturally occurring bile acid. Its primary role in the liver is to help alter the composition of bile. Bile is a fluid produced by the liver that aids in digestion, particularly the breakdown of fats. However, in certain liver conditions, the balance of bile acids can become disrupted, leading to damage. Ursodiol works by increasing the proportion of less toxic bile acids in the bile, thereby reducing the stress on liver cells.
This shift in bile acid composition has several important effects. Firstly, it can help to dissolve certain types of gallstones, particularly cholesterol gallstones, by reducing cholesterol saturation in bile. Secondly, and crucially for liver health, ursodiol has cytoprotective effects. This means it helps to shield liver cells from the damaging effects of toxic bile acids. It achieves this by several mechanisms:
- Reducing the absorption of cholesterol in the gut.
- Decreasing the production of cholesterol by the liver.
- Stabilizing the membranes of liver cells.
- Modulating immune responses within the liver.
The overall impact of these actions is a significant improvement in liver function and a reduction in liver inflammation. For individuals suffering from conditions like primary biliary cholangitis (PBC), ursodiol is a cornerstone of treatment. PBC is a chronic disease where the bile ducts in the liver are slowly destroyed, leading to bile buildup and liver damage. Ursodiol helps to slow the progression of this disease by:
- Protecting the bile ducts from further injury.
- Reducing the buildup of damaging bile acids.
- Improving liver enzyme levels, which are indicators of liver health.

Beyond its direct effects on bile acids, ursodiol also exhibits anti-inflammatory and antioxidant properties, further contributing to its protective role in the liver. It essentially creates a more favorable environment for the liver to heal and function optimally, making it a valuable tool in managing various liver ailments.
